Mush was [1] a browser-based free-to-play multiplayer game by the French company Motion Twin. [2] The game was first available in French on 14 January 2013. [ 3 ] [ 4 ] From August 2013, the English version of the game was in closed beta phase, which ended before 5 November 2013 when the game went live.

In multiplayer online games, a MUSH (a backronymed [1] variation on MUD most often expanded as Multi-User Shared Hallucination, [2] [3] [4] though Multi-User Shared Hack, [5] Habitat, and Holodeck are also observed) is a text-based online social medium to which multiple users are connected at the same time.

The original MUD game was closed down in late 1987, [27] reportedly under pressure from CompuServe, to whom Richard Bartle had licensed the game. This left MIST , a derivative of MUD1 with similar gameplay, as the only remaining MUD running on the University of Essex network, becoming one of the first of its kind to attain broad popularity.
